自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(34)
  • 资源 (1)
  • 问答 (1)
  • 收藏
  • 关注

转载 mysql定时执行sql语句

登录mysql服务器mysql -u root -p查看event是否开启show variables like '%sche%'; 将事件计划开启set global event_scheduler =1;创建存储过程testCREATE PROCEDURE test () BEGIN update examinfo SET...

2019-01-31 14:05:43 2337

转载 比较两个表中数据存在的差异(比如可以用于对账)

存在t1 不存在t2的数据:select * from table1 t1 where not exists (select 1 from table2 t2 where t1.id = t2.id )存在t2 不存在t1的数据:select * from table2 t2 where not exists (select 1 from table1 t1 where t1.id = t2...

2019-01-31 13:52:42 2236

转载 Reactor反应器模式转载

前言          本文针对Reactor模式从四个方面进行了阐述,首先简单介绍了Reactor模式是什么;其次,阐述了为什么使用Reactor模式;再次,针对实际生活的应用场景,分析了在什么场景下使用Reactor模式;最后,着重分析讲解了如何...

2019-01-27 10:58:11 156

转载 TCP(Transmission Control Protocol)三次握手四次挥手

TCP(Transmission Control Protocol) 传输控制协议三次握手TCP是主机对主机层的传输控制协议,提供可靠的连接服务,采用三次握手确认建立一个连接:位码即tcp标志位,有6种标示:SYN(synchronous建立联机) ACK(acknowledgement 确认) PSH(push传送) FIN(finish结束) RST(reset重置) URG(urgen...

2019-01-27 02:24:18 233

转载 Netty中的那些坑

Netty中的那些坑(上篇)最近开发了一个纯异步的redis客户端,算是比较深入的使用了一把netty。在使用过程中一边优化,一边解决各种坑。儿这些坑大部分基本上是Netty4对Netty3的改进部分引起的。注:这里说的坑不是说netty不好,只是如果这些地方不注意,或者不去看netty的代码,就有可能掉进去了。坑1: Netty 4的线程模型转变在Netty 3的时候,upstream是...

2019-01-27 01:51:12 484

转载 同步异步阻塞非阻塞

例二老张爱喝茶,废话不说,煮开水。出场人物:老张,水壶两把(普通水壶,简称水壶;会响的水壶,简称响水壶)。1 老张把水壶放到火上,立等水开。(同步阻塞)老张觉得自己有点傻2 老张把水壶放到火上,去客厅看电视,时不时去厨房看看水开没有。(同步非阻塞)老张还是觉得自己有点傻,于是变高端了,买了把会响笛的那种水壶。水开之后,能大声发出嘀~~~~的噪音。3 老张把响水壶放到火上,立等水开。(...

2019-01-27 00:36:06 92

原创 Reactor

Reactor模式1:

2019-01-26 23:42:05 368

转载 jstack分析线程等待、死锁问题

转自:https://www.cnblogs.com/wuchanming/p/7766994.htmlhttps://www.cnblogs.com/kongzhongqijing/articles/3630264.html背景记得前段时间,同事说他们测试环境的服务器cpu使用率一直处于100%,本地又没有...

2019-01-25 01:11:08 2710

转载 tomcat bio和nio

https://www.cnblogs.com/kismetv/p/7806063.html

2019-01-24 17:37:30 144

转载 Java的Executor框架和线程池实现原理

版权声明:本文为博主原创文章,未经博主允许不得转载。 https://blog.csdn.net/tuke_tuke/article/details/51353925 </div> <link rel="stylesheet" href="https://csdnimg.cn/release/phoe...

2019-01-24 17:08:46 155

转载 TCP 连接的 TIME_WAIT 过多 导致 Tomcat 假死

最近系统二次开发之后,发现使用的 Tomcat 7 会经常假死。前端点击页面无任何反应,打开firebug,很多链接一直在等待服务器的反应。查看服务器的状态,CPU占用很少,最多不超过10%,一般只有2%,3%左右,内存占用倒是接近80, 90%。一开始怀疑是tomcat内存配置不够,但是打开 jvisualvm.exe 分析,发现Tomcat 占用的堆内存没有什么问题。因为是假死,所以最后怀疑到...

2019-01-24 11:51:55 439

原创 看源码过程中的几个术语

1.注册 即将一个对象A的引用给到另一个对象B的属性中,让对象B能够在对象B的方法中调用对象A中方法和属性。但是通常我们最常用的应该是让A实现一个接口比如A_interface(接口中定义方法),再在B属性中定义A_interface属性。我们再将A注册到B中。这样B中调用A_interface的方法就会调其实现类A中的方法。...

2019-01-24 10:03:02 185

原创 tomat的response filter servlet,我们操作的内容如何放回给浏览器的

这里想说明一个问题,就是所有响应的内容都在respones里,我们i可以在过滤器这里获取到response里所有的内容。我可以看到servlet和filter中的方法都是没有返回值的,他们只是负责操作request和response,对response的操作就是把我们想要给浏览器的内容放到response里,然后tomcat会把response返回给浏览器。我们所有的响应内容不管是重定向还是转发还...

2019-01-24 03:23:28 473

转载 Netty系列四:第一个Netty程序(业务线程异步)

版权声明:本文为博主原创文章,未经博主允许也可以随便转载。 https://blog.csdn.net/cj2580/article/details/78134134 </div> <div id="content_views...

2019-01-23 00:02:45 366

转载 Netty系列三:netty线程模型

版权声明:本文为博主原创文章,未经博主允许也可以随便转载。 https://blog.csdn.net/cj2580/article/details/78124780 </div> <div id="content_views...

2019-01-22 23:58:46 85

转载 Netty系列二:TCP/IP 协议三次握手

版权声明:本文为博主原创文章,未经博主允许也可以随便转载。 https://blog.csdn.net/cj2580/article/details/70877094 </div> <link rel="stylesheet" href="https://csdnimg.cn/release/phoe...

2019-01-22 23:56:30 1978

转载 Netty系列一:IO网络模型(select/poll/epoll)

版权声明:本文为博主原创文章,未经博主允许也可以随便转载。 https://blog.csdn.net/cj2580/article/details/78087101 </div> <div id="content_views" class="markdown_views prism-atom-one...

2019-01-22 23:55:06 268

转载 QPS 和并发:如何衡量服务器端性能

                  QPS 和并发:如何衡量服务器端性能        &a

2019-01-22 21:03:15 364

转载 对于并发线程数的设置的一些理解

版权声明:本文为博主原创文章,未经博主允许不得转载。 https://blog.csdn.net/Megustas_JJC/article/details/77686588 </div> <div id="content_views" class="markdown_views prism-atom-...

2019-01-22 20:45:37 857

转载 Spring事务异常回滚,捕获异常不抛出就不会回滚

版权声明:本文为博主原创文章,未经博主允许不得转载。如需转载,请标明转载地址!!!! https://blog.csdn.net/Crystalqy/article/details/79045512 </div> <link rel="stylesheet" href="https://csdnimg...

2019-01-22 01:09:02 205

转载 Ehcache使用前要了解的概念

使用spring cache和ehcache之前必须了解的http://www.cnblogs.com/jianjianyang/p/4933016.htmlspring整合ehcache 注解实现查询缓存,并实现实时缓存更新或删除http://www.cnblogs.com/jianjianyang/p/4938765.html...

2019-01-21 22:24:52 131

原创 Shiro的authc过滤器的执行流程

Shiro的authc过滤器的执行流程1.先執行isAccessAllowed(),通過subject.isAuthenticated()判斷當前session中的subject是否已经登陆过。如果在当前session即会话中已经登陆过,返回true,authc过滤器放行请求到loginUrl。**问题?:

2019-01-19 18:10:56 15003

转载 shiro当用户不先注销登陆而直接再次登陆时不会跳转到新登录用户的问题

版权声明:本文为博主原创文章,未经博主允许不得转载。 https://blog.csdn.net/qq_27273089/article/details/63684557 </div> <div id="content_views" class="markdown_views"> &...

2019-01-19 12:54:09 946

转载 shiro的remember功能

问题shiro中提供了rememberMe功能,它用起来是这样的UsernamePasswordToken token = new UsernamePasswordToken(loginForm.getUsername(),loginForm.getPassword()); if(loginForm.getRememberMe(...

2019-01-19 12:51:30 867

转载 Session机制详解

Session机制详解ref:http://justsee.iteye.com/blog/1570652虽然session机制在web应用程序中被采用已经很长时间了,但是仍然有很多人不清楚session机制的本质,以至不能正确的应用这一技术。本文将详细讨论session的工作机制并且对在Java web application中应用session机制时常见的问题作出解答。一、术语sessio...

2019-01-19 12:44:34 169

转载 安全认证框架Shiro 二- shiro过滤器工作原理

版权声明:本文为博主原创文章,未经博主允许不得转载。 https://blog.csdn.net/achenyuan/article/details/78541529 </div> <div id="content_views...

2019-01-19 10:32:14 202

转载 spring加載xsd文件出錯或者慢

版权声明:本文为博主原创文章,未经博主允许不得转载。 https://blog.csdn.net/bluishglc/article/details/7596118 </div> <link rel="stylesheet" ...

2019-01-18 22:31:14 641

转载 shiro拦截器处理链执行顺序

shiro拦截器处理链执行顺序A1:根据到spring容器查找实现bean,并根据配置把相应的url请求委托给它去执行。A21:SpringShiroFilter是ShiroFilterFactoryBean的内部类,会执行doFilter()方法。A21没有重写父类的doFilter方法,因此会去寻找父类中的实现,最终调用OncePerRequestFilter(A23)的该方法。A23:...

2019-01-18 21:03:30 7521 1

转载 eclipse debug调试

版权声明:本文为博主原创文章,未经博主允许不得转载。 https://blog.csdn.net/u011781521/article/details/55000066 </div> <link rel="stylesheet" href="https://csdnimg.cn/release/pho...

2019-01-17 16:02:50 90

转载 spring整合shiro权限管理与数据库设计

版权声明:本文为博主原创文章,未经博主允许不得转载。 https://blog.csdn.net/hzw2312/article/details/54612962 </div> <link rel="stylesheet" href="https://csdnimg.cn/release/phoeni...

2019-01-16 01:46:29 584

原创 Shiro流程梳理

一、shiro通过过滤器来拦截所有请求这个过滤器是spring的委托过滤器,真正的过滤器是在spring容器中配置的shiro类。因为org.springframework.web.filter.DelegatingFilterProxy这个过滤器是也是spring的,也是在spring容器中,所以spring可以把spring容器中的shiro类装配到这个类的属性上,spring默认是使用中的...

2019-01-15 22:45:35 151

转载 Shiro的基于字符串通配符的权限表达式

深入理解Apache Shiro的Permissions自己的理解:了解shiro的权限表达式有助于我们看到表达式就知道这个表达式的含义,我们就可以很方便的对资源设置权限时知道应该给这个资源什么样的权限表达式了。比如:我们有四张表:机构organization、用户user、角色role、资源resource![我们有四张表机构organzition、](https://img-blog.c...

2019-01-15 22:11:09 6907

转载 shiro对资源如何做权限控制即怎么设计哪些资源需要哪些权限

**我们使用shiro进行权限控制 有以下四种方式****1.  URL拦截权限控制:基于filter过滤器实现**我们在spring配置文件中配置shiroFilter时配置<!--指定URL级别拦截策略  --><property name="filterCh

2019-01-15 21:45:43 1569

转载 如何转载CSDN文章

转载于:http://blog.csdn.net/jiangping_zhu/article/details/18044109作者:包心菜加糯米饭1、找到要转载的文章,用chrome浏览器打开,右键选择审查元素2、在chrome中下方的框里找到对应的内容,html脚本中找到对应的节点,选中节点,网页上被选中内容会被高亮显示,然后右键菜单选中 Copy as HTML3、进入个人"管...

2019-01-15 21:31:37 393

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除